C. Course FunctionsCourse management is essential in maintaining an organized institution dashboard. Duplicat-ing courses each term ensures that new HOL content, or corrections, are incorporated into your course and that student data is never lost. Students should never be deleted to re-use a course because their data will be lost and cannot be recovered. Course session dates should never be adjusted to re-use a course. HOL content updates cannot be added to courses that a student has previously started. Course management includes the ability to:• Preview courses

• Duplicate courses

• Deactivate and archive courses

• Remove courses

• Change course dates

Deactivating and Archiving a Course

This is an important feature utilized to clean up the Institution Dashboard. Deactivating a course does not delete it, but rather archives it from the Dashboard so that the current courses are easily found. All student data is kept intact, course attributes can still be viewed, and the course can be reactivated, or duplicated at any time.

Removing a Course

This is a permanent removal of a course along with the student information. Use caution when removing a course. When selecting the Remove Course button on the Course Management screen a warning will appear. The course will be permanently removed from the Institution Dashboard.

Changing the Dates on a Course

Only change dates to close or deactivate a course. Do not use this feature to reuse a course. A course should be duplicated if it is needed for the next term, and the old course should be deactivated (archived) by adding an end date to the Course Session Dates.

Source Code for Data Tables

» To match standard appearance of HOL Data Tables use the following codes in the first row of the table’s code:

9 lrn_width_auto table

9 table-bordered

9 table-condensed

Page 42: HOL Cloud Procedures Instructorsspots.augusta.edu/tcolbert/PHYS1112L-Labs/PHYS1112L-SUMMER 2… · A. Student Overview ... This role designates an individual as the Institution’s

an Emersive Learning Company 866 206 0773 | www.HOLscience.com

HOL Cloud Procedures Instructors

39

» To add a light gray background color to empty cells of a data table, add the following code to the desired cell <td>:

9 <td style=”background-color:lightgray”>

» To merge cells in a data table, add the following code to the desired cell to merge <td>:

9 <td colspan=”2” rowspan=”1”>

�NOTE:� You can adjust these numbers to allow for the number of columns and rows you want a cell to include.

9 Delete the extra <td> coding so that there are the same number of <td> lines as there are columns.

» Examples of the codes listed above are highlighted below:

<table class=”learnDataTable lrn_width_auto table table-4-cols table-bordered table-condensed table-medium-cols”>

<tbody> <tr> <td style=”background-color:lightgray”> </td> <td>Magnification</td> <td>Comments</td> </tr> <tr> <td>Trial 1</td> <td>{{response}}</td> <td>{{response}}</td> </tr> <tr> <td>Trial 2</td> <td>{{response}}</td> <td>{{response}}</td> </tr> <tr> <td colspan=”2” rowspan=”1”>Total</td> <td>{{response}}</td> </tr> </tbody> </table>

» The image below shows the standard HOL source code for all tables, and a brief intro to how each cell is laid out in the source code.
